21 boys have been named Tervon since 1992, though it isn't currently a top-ranked name.
According to the U.S. Social Security Administration, Tervon has been recorded 21 times among boys since 1992, though it is not among the currently most-used boys names, with its heaviest use in the 1990s. This profile covers year-by-year birth trends, decade totals, and state-level distribution, all derived directly from SSA birth-registration files spanning 1992 to 2003.
